Ammattikoodi, meaning "occupational code" in Finnish, is a system used for classifying occupations in Finland. It is based on the international standard Classification of Occupations (ISCO) developed by the International Labour Organization (ILO). The Finnish version, often referred to as the Finnish standard classification of occupations, is maintained by Statistics Finland.
